Why Eye Movement Is the Foundation of Safe Driving
Most new drivers focus their eyes on the bumper of the car in front of them. It feels logical — that's the nearest threat. But experienced drivers look much farther down the road, and that single habit accounts for a large part of what separates calm, controlled driving from last-second reactions.
Where your eyes point determines what information your brain receives. If you're only looking 50 feet ahead at 45 mph, you're giving yourself roughly three-quarters of a second to identify and respond to a hazard. Look 12 seconds ahead — roughly 800 feet at highway speed — and you have time to plan, not just react.
Driver training programs like those based on the Smith System and the SIPDE process (Scan, Identify, Predict, Decide, Execute) were built around this idea. Both treat eye movement as a learnable skill, not a natural talent. This article breaks down the core practices drawn from those frameworks so you can apply them on your next drive. The Core Scanning Practices Every Driver Should Know
These practices are drawn from established driver education frameworks used in commercial fleet training and standard licensing programs. They are practical, not theoretical — you can start applying them today.
Look 12–15 seconds ahead on open roads
Looking further down the road gives your brain more processing time before a situation becomes critical. It also reduces unnecessary braking and steering corrections, which smooths out your driving and reduces fatigue for passengers and other road users.
Check your mirrors every 5–8 seconds
Your rear and side mirrors give you a constantly updating picture of the traffic around you, not just in front. Without regular mirror checks, lane changes and braking decisions are made with incomplete information about what's behind and beside you.
Never fix your gaze on one point for more than two seconds
Extended fixation — called 'target fixation' — narrows your awareness and delays your detection of hazards entering your peripheral vision. Commercial driver training programs treat the two-second rule for gaze duration as a core safety threshold.
Scan intersections before you enter them, not as you arrive
Intersections are the most statistically dangerous spots on any road. Checking cross-traffic as you approach — rather than at the stop line — gives you time to react if someone runs a red light or a pedestrian steps off the curb.
Use your peripheral vision actively, not just your central focus
Human peripheral vision detects motion more effectively than central vision. Trained drivers use this by keeping their central focus on the road ahead while staying receptive to movement at the edges — driveways, sidewalks, side streets.
Adjust your scanning distance based on speed and conditions
The faster you travel, the farther ahead you need to be looking to maintain the same reaction time. Wet roads, fog, or heavy traffic all reduce how far you can effectively see — your visual search zone should shrink accordingly.

Adapting Your Scan to Different Road Environments
No single scanning pattern works perfectly in every situation. City streets, highways, and rural roads each demand a different visual approach.
City driving compresses your reaction space. Intersections appear frequently, pedestrians enter your path unexpectedly, and parked cars can hide cyclists or children. In urban environments, your scan must be more active — checking cross-traffic at every intersection, watching sidewalk edges, and tracking the behavior of vehicles two or three cars ahead. Highway driving allows a longer forward look — 15 to 20 seconds ahead is realistic — but introduces new risks: lane-change conflicts, trucks with larger blind spots, and the danger of fixating on the same point while cruise control holds a steady speed.
Night driving shrinks your effective scan zone because headlights only illuminate so far. Your eyes also take longer to adjust between bright oncoming headlights and dark road sections. Night driving risks explains why many drivers underestimate how much visibility loss affects reaction time.
Scanning Habits Change With Passenger Count
Having passengers — especially in the backseat — can subtly pull your visual attention away from the road. Research on new drivers shows that social interaction inside the vehicle is a meaningful distraction risk. Being aware of this tendency is the first step toward managing it. Keep conversations brief during demanding driving situations like merging, navigating intersections, or driving in low visibility.
Distractions — especially phone use — collapse all of these scanning habits instantly. Even a hands-free call occupies mental bandwidth that your visual system needs to process what your eyes are picking up.
